In an exclusive interview with 'Closer,' Hollywood legend Kirk Douglas, 98, shares the secrets behind his 60-year marriage to his beloved wife, Anne.
“I never thought of our marriage as unique,” Kirk tells 'Closer.' “I fell in love with a girl, and after 60 years, I still love her.”
So it’s no surprise that Kirk still knows how to turn up the charm. His new book of love poetry, 'Life Could Be Verse,' was written for Anne, he says. “There’s a poem in there I like that starts, ‘Romance begins at 80,’” Anne, 84, tells 'Closer' of her husband’s 11th tome. She winks. “It took him a long time.”

Kirk and Anne in September 2013.
Anne’s playful wit is one of the first things that attracted Kirk, and it continues to keep him guessing. “She’s unpredictable,” he confides to 'Closer.' “I don’t know what she’s going to say or do. I love the intrigue.”
Kirk tells 'Closer,' “Marriage is not just about love, but friendship.”

Over the years, however, they faced serious challenges to their union. Kirk had affairs, but Anne forgave him. “After 60 years of marriage, you go through a lot of obstacles — and all of them were beautiful!” she says knowingly.

Kirk and Anne’s relationship is a rare example of an enduring Hollywood marriage, which has inspired son Michael Douglas. “We have a very close, loving and supportive relationship,” Michael exclusively tells 'Closer,' adding that his dad and stepmom “have been a great lesson in how to conduct and live your third act.”
For their 60th anniversary, Michael feted the couple by transforming Greystone Manor into an old-timey Cocoanut Grove–style nightclub. “It was easy to see my son is rich,” Kirk tells 'Closer.' “It was so lush. Michael is guilty of liking to do the unexpected.”
“That was the most emotional and loving evening — so fantastic,” Anne gushes. “The 60 years we spent together were all represented; they had photos and mementos from way back. Michael is very romantic, and he organized it with all the affection and love he has for both of us.”
